  18. Link to article Seven players mentioned are... ILB Mark Robinson (PIT) - 2022 seventh round pick that was a core special teams player and was productive in the final preseason game vs. CAR (3 TKLs, 1 FF, 1 FR). Undersized at 5'11" 235 lbs. CB O'Donnell Fortune (NYG) - UDFA rookie out of South Carolina (and a Sumter native). 6'1", 185lbs frame fits the Panthers' preference for long and lanky CBs. Panthers' evaluators got a lot of time with him during the Shrine Bowl, his pro day, and the combine. CB Damarri Mathis (DEN) - 2022 fourth-round pick that played for Evero his rookie season at 5'11" 195lbs both inside and outside. Did well under Evero (16 games, 11 starts, 65 TKLs, 7 PBUs) but slid down the depth chart after he left. Started just seven of 27 games the last two seasons. DB Dean Clark (NYJ) - Fresno State UDFA with good size (6'1" 205lbs) and preseason production (5 TKLs, 1 INT, 2 PBUs) that can also play special teams. The Panthers have claimed a player from the Jets in each of the past two seasons (having also played the Jets both times in preseason though). OLB Brennan Jackson (LAR) - 2024 fifth-rounder that notched three sacks in the preseason. Played special teams and rotated in on defense that could potentially be an upgrade from DJ Johnson. DB Beau Brade (BAL) - 2024 UDFA that appeared in 11 games and played 70% of the special teams snaps. Has the size (6'0" 209lbs) that the team covets at safety. K Ben Sauls (PIT) - 24yrs old and went four-for-four against Carolina in preseason. Made 21 of 24 FGs during his final college season at Pitt.
